middlelands

in this body i carry dichotomy
& a heavy need
to be seen / bones of the elbow
churn out marrow / i am always making

more of myself / mixed all to hell /
measure me in percentages
build a border / between my lungs
& bring me to your bed

where you can tell me / i’m beautiful
a flavor / you haven’t tried
yet / when you fall asleep / i’ll sneak
to the door, deep-dream the air

i’ll find my father in the field /
i’ll read him Kansas Boy / i swear we hear
the ocean / i swear it on all
my landlocked loves


Kimberly Ramos is a queer, Filipina writer from Missouri. They are currently an undergraduate of Philosophy and Creative Writing at Truman State University. Their work has been published in Southern Humanities Review, Jet Fuel Review, and West Trade Review, among others. Their forthcoming chapbook The Beginner's Guide to Minor Gods & Other Small Spirits is set for publication with Unsolicited Press in 2023.
